Back to all jobs

[Remote] Senior Firmware Engineer, ASIC

Work from home Full-time role Hiring

Note: The job is a remote job and is open to candidates in USA. K2 Space Corporation is building the largest and highest-power satellites ever flown, and they are seeking a Senior Embedded Firmware Engineer to develop and enhance low‑level embedded firmware for high‑performance mixed‑signal and digital SoCs. The role involves contributing to the validation and production readiness of custom silicon by working closely with various engineering teams to implement and validate core firmware components.

Responsibilities

  • Contribute to the design and implementation of embedded firmware architecture, including boot flows, HAL components, drivers, and system services
  • Develop low‑level firmware in C/C++ (and assembly when required) for CPUs, DSPs, and microcontrollers within custom SoCs
  • Implement and maintain bootloaders, secure boot flows, and early hardware initialization sequences
  • Develop device drivers for on‑chip peripherals such as DMA engines, memory controllers, interconnects, SerDes, ADC/DAC interfaces, timers, and GPIO
  • Participate in pre‑silicon firmware development and validation activities
  • Support post‑silicon bring‑up, including power‑on sequencing, clock/reset initialization, memory bring‑up, and peripheral testing
  • Debug hardware/firmware interactions using JTAG, logic analyzers, oscilloscopes, trace tools, and custom debug instrumentation
  • Collaborate with SoC architects and designers to refine register maps, memory maps, interrupt structures, DMA flows, and debug infrastructure
  • Provide firmware input during design reviews and silicon development milestones
  • Bring up and integrate RTOS or bare‑metal environments
  • Support integration with higher‑level system software or application processors
  • Implement robust error handling, logging, and recovery mechanisms
  • Contribute to manufacturing test firmware, production firmware, and field diagnostics
  • Help ensure long‑term maintainability and scalability of firmware across multiple SoC generations

Skills

  • 5+ years of experience in embedded firmware development for SoCs or complex embedded systems
  • Strong proficiency in C/C++ for embedded systems and a solid understanding of low‑level hardware interactions
  • Hands‑on experience with SoC bring‑up or board‑level bring‑up
  • Strong understanding of CPU architectures (ARM, RISC‑V, or similar), memory systems (SRAM, DRAM, DDR, caches), interrupts, DMA, and low‑power states
  • Experience collaborating with ASIC/SoC design or hardware engineering teams
  • Demonstrated ability to debug complex hardware/firmware issues
  • Experience with secure boot, hardware security modules, or cryptographic accelerators
  • Familiarity with pre‑silicon environments such as RTL simulation, emulation, or FPGA prototyping
  • Experience with high‑speed interfaces (PCIe, Ethernet, JESD, SerDes)
  • Background in satellite communication, networking, compute, automotive, or other high‑reliability systems
  • Experience developing firmware for radiation‑tolerant or mission‑critical systems

Benefits

  • Equity in the company
  • Comprehensive benefits package including paid time off, medical/dental/vision/ coverage, life insurance, paid parental leave, and many other perks

Company Overview

  • Making previously impossible missions possible It was founded in 2022, and is headquartered in Torrance, California, USA, with a workforce of 51-200 employees. Its website is https://www.k2space.com.
  • Apply To This Job

    Related remote jobs

    [Remote] Remote Accountant

    Work from home Full-time role

    [Remote] Senior Firmware Engineer, ASIC

    Work from home Full-time role

    [Remote] Senior Sales Director - Central

    Work from home Full-time role

    [Remote] Account Executive - Enterprise (Arizona)

    Work from home Full-time role

    [Remote] Senior Software Engineer (Python / Django)

    Work from home Full-time role

    [Remote] Project Manager

    Work from home Full-time role

    [Remote] Software Engineer - GPU Kernels

    Work from home Full-time role

    [Remote] Senior Business Solutions Analyst (Pension Administration)

    Work from home Full-time role

    [Remote] Technical Recruiter

    Work from home Full-time role

    [Remote] Senior Data Engineer (Healthcare Data)

    Work from home Full-time role

    Online Veterinary Medicine Educator - Part-time

    Work from home Full-time role

    Program Manager, Enterprise Delivery

    Work from home Full-time role

    Experienced Customer Experience Chatroom Operator – Remote Conversion Improvement Team

    Work from home Full-time role

    Part-Time Remote Data Entry Specialist - Flexible Work From Home Opportunity in Healthcare Information Management

    Work from home Full-time role

    Senior CX AI Specialist

    Work from home Full-time role

    Carrier Operations Coordinator

    Work from home Full-time role

    Part Time - Customer Service Associate - Tool Rental - Flexible Erie, CO 3444 at arenaflex

    Work from home Full-time role

    Experienced Entry-Level Amazon Virtual Customer Service Representative – Remote Customer Support Role

    Work from home Full-time role

    ||Entry-Level Virtual Associate | Work From Anywhere

    Work from home Full-time role

    Experienced Sr. Manager, Social Media Customer Support – Disney+ and Arenaflex Direct-to-Consumer Brands

    Work from home Full-time role